Server Notices
|
||||
==============
|
||||
|
||||
.. _module:server-notices:
|
||||
|
||||
Homeserver hosts often want to send messages to users in an official capacity,
|
||||
or have resource limits which affect a user's ability to use the homeserver.
|
||||
For example, the homeserver may be limited to a certain number of active users
|
||||
per month and has exceeded that limit. To communicate this failure to users,
|
||||
the homeserver would use the Server Notices room.
|
||||
|
||||
The aesthetics of the room (name, topic, avatar, etc) are left as an implementation
|
||||
detail. It is recommended that the homeserver decorate the room such that it looks
|
||||
like an official room to users.
|
||||
|
||||
Events
|
||||
------
|
||||
Notices are sent to the client as normal ``m.room.message`` events with a
|
||||
``msgtype`` of ``m.server_notice`` in the server notices room. Events with
|
||||
a ``m.server_notice`` ``msgtype`` outside of the server notice room must
|
||||
be ignored by clients.
|
||||
|
||||
The specified values for ``server_notice_type`` are:
|
||||
|
||||
:``m.server_notice.usage_limit_reached``:
|
||||
The server has exceeded some limit which requires the server administrator
|
||||
to intervene. The ``limit_type`` describes the kind of limit reached.
|
||||
The specified values for ``limit_type`` are:
|
||||
|
||||
:``monthly_active_user``:
|
||||
The server's number of active users in the last 30 days has exceeded the
|
||||
maximum. New connections are being refused by the server. What defines
|
||||
"active" is left as an implementation detail, however servers are encouraged
|
||||
to treat syncing users as "active".

Client behaviour
|
||||
----------------
|
||||
Clients can identify the server notices room by the ``m.server_notice`` tag
|
||||
on the room. Active notices are represented by the `pinned events <#m-room-pinned-events>`_
|
||||
in the server notices room. Server notice events pinned in that room should
|
||||
be shown to the user through special UI and not through the normal pinned
|
||||
events interface in the client. For example, clients may show warning banners
|
||||
or bring up dialogs to get the user's attention. Events which are not server
|
||||
notice events and are pinned in the server notices room should be shown just
|
||||
like any other pinned event in a room.
|
||||
|
||||
The client must not expect to be able to reject an invite to join the server
|
||||
notices room. Attempting to reject the invite must result in a
|
||||
``M_CANNOT_LEAVE_SERVER_NOTICE_ROOM`` error. Servers should not prevent the user
|
||||
leaving the room after joining the server notices room, however the same error
|
||||
code must be used if the server will prevent leaving the room.
|
||||
|
||||
Server behaviour
|
||||
----------------
|
||||
Servers should manage exactly 1 server notices room per user. Servers must
|
||||
identify this room to clients with the ``m.server_notice`` tag. Servers should
|
||||
invite the target user rather than automatically join them to the server notice
|
||||
room.
|
||||
|
||||
How servers send notices to clients, and which user they use to send the events,
|
||||
is left as an implementation detail for the server.
